Microsoft Dynamics GP, previously called Great Plains, has a lengthier history than almost any other ERP platform made for Windows. Microsoft Dynamics GP is a proven, full-featured application and is one of the most popular ERP systems for small and mid-size businesses, with around 50,000 active customers worldwide. A number of organizations who have relied on Dynamics GP for years or decades have been able to postpone upgrades long enough that they are now running seriously out-of-date software and outmoded network infrastructure. This is dangerous. At the same time, a common theme we hear from new customers is that they have trouble locating veteran Microsoft Dynamics GP experts who can provide in-depth knowledge about how to update their Dynamics GP system efficiently and derive the maximum benefit out of the application.
The longer an organization attempts to make do with outdated versions of Microsoft Dynamics GP, the more challenging the upgrade process becomes. If server hardware or disk systems fail, there could be no suitable hardware available to use as substitutes. When editions of Windows Server used to host Dynamics GP arrive at end-of-support (EOS) status, vital security patches are no longer distributed. Current editions of Microsoft SQL Server may not work with your important GP customizations. Next-generation products such as Power BI may not be an option.
